What are the legal requirements for construction of building projects within the newly formed GBA limits in Bangalore?

Before starting any new building construction, legal compliance is mandatory.

1. Land Verification

  • Clear title deed
  • Encumbrance Certificate (EC)
  • Conversion certificate (if agricultural land)
  • Khata registration

2. Building Plan Approval

Under the BBMP/BDA or relevant GBA authority, you must obtain:

  • Sanctioned building plan
  • Commencement certificate
  • Zoning clearance

Without approvals, house construction work can face penalties or demolition risks.

3. Utility Approvals

  • BWSSB water connection
  • BESCOM electricity connection
  • Borewell permission (if required)

Follow all legal laws to avoid delays in your construction house project. This ensures the work progresses without unnecessary issues. It also ensures that the project meets legal requirements.

How Does the Building Construction Process Work in Bangalore?

The building construction process follows a structured execution method.

1. Site Preparation

  • Clearing debris
  • Layout marking
  • Temporary fencing

2. Excavation & Foundation

Foundation is critical in house construction work:

  • Excavation
  • PCC (Plain Cement Concrete)
  • Reinforcement
  • Footing concrete

A strong foundation ensures durable construction and a house’s performance.

3. Plinth & Ground Slab

  • Plinth beam construction
  • Backfilling
  • Compaction
  • Ground floor slab casting

This stage completes the base for house-building construction.

4. Structural Framework

  • Column casting
  • Beam placement
  • Slab concreting

Proper curing ensures structural strength in new building construction.

Mistakes to Avoid During House Construction

Building a home involves many possible mistakes. Understanding the most common ones helps you prevent issues and complete your project smoothly and successfully.

1. Skipping Soil Testing

Ignoring soil analysis can cause foundation cracks. It can also create structural instability in new building construction.

2. Underestimating the Budget

Unexpected costs in house building are common. Always keep 10–15% contingency funds.

3. Poor Contractor Selection

Choosing based solely on low cost can compromise the quality of construction of house projects.

4. Ignoring Supervision

Regular inspections can help guarantee that a building’s necessary materials are being utilized for their intended purposes and that all parts of the building construction process are following proper procedures.

Estimated Time frames for Construction of Houses in Bangalore.

A typical newly constructed house on the replatting of a standard 30×40 or a standard 40×60 plot takes approximately 8 – 14 months to complete.

The exact timeline depends on various factors such as:

  • Plot size
  • Number of floors
  • Material selection
  • Weather conditions
  • Approval delays

Typical Timeline Breakdown:

  • Planning & Approvals: 1–2 months
  • Foundation & Structure: 3–4 months
  • Masonry & Services: 2–3 months
  • Finishing & Interiors: 2–4 months

This timeline helps homeowners budget and set expectations for home-building projects.

Average Build Cost in 2026

Residential building expenses within Bangalore are anticipated for 2026 as follows:

  • Premium grade or higher finishes could average between 2500 – 3500+ rupees ($30.00 USD/per sq ft).
  • Standard quality construction could come in at approximately 1800 – 2500 rupees ($23.00 – 30.00 USD/per sq ft).

The final cost of building house projects depends on:

  • Material quality
  • Architectural complexity
  • Interior customization
  • Smart home features

Smart budgeting ensures a smooth process when you build a house.

Importance of Quality Checks at Every Stage

Quality control plays a major role in the successful house construction step by step process execution.

Stage-wise quality checks should include:

  • Concrete cube testing during slab casting
  • Steel reinforcement verification
  • Waterproofing inspection before tiling
  • Plumbing pressure testing
  • Electrical load testing

These inspections prevent structural damage and expensive repairs after house construction work completion.

A. Is RERA registration required for residential construction in Bangalore?

RERA registration is compulsory for specific residential projects. This mainly applies to larger developments that meet the prescribed size or unit criteria under the regulations.

B. Can I get a home loan for new home construction on my own plot?

Yes, banks provide construction loans for new home construction, subject to approved plans and stage-wise disbursement during the steps of construction.

C. What additional costs should I consider while building house projects?

Apart from base construction cost, other charges may include approval fees, interiors, landscaping, utility deposits, and contingency prices while building house.
